Форум программистов, компьютерный форум CyberForum.ru

С++ для начинающих

Войти
Регистрация
Восстановить пароль
 
Анна7505
0 / 0 / 0
Регистрация: 20.01.2014
Сообщений: 7
#1

Числа Фибоначчи - C++

23.04.2014, 17:33. Просмотров 850. Ответов 2
Метки нет (Все метки)

Числа Фибоначчи http://www.cyberforum.ru/cgi-bin/latex.cgi?{u}_{0},{u}_{1},{u}_{2},... определяются следующим образом: http://www.cyberforum.ru/cgi-bin/latex.cgi?{u}_{0}=0,{u}_{1}=1,{u}_{n}={u}_{n-1}+{u}_{n-2} (n=2,3,...). Составить программу вычисления http://www.cyberforum.ru/cgi-bin/latex.cgi?{u}_{n} для данного неотъемлемого целого n, которая будет включать рекурсивную функцию, которая основана на использовании соотношения http://www.cyberforum.ru/cgi-bin/latex.cgi?{u}_{n}={u}_{n-1}+{u}_{n-2}
Similar
Эксперт
41792 / 34177 / 6122
Регистрация: 12.04.2006
Сообщений: 57,940
23.04.2014, 17:33     Числа Фибоначчи
Посмотрите здесь:

Числа Фибоначчи, простые числа и делители - C++
Write a menu() function that prints the following menu and returns the selected choice: 1. Fibonacci series 2. Prime numbers 3....

числа Фибоначчи - C++
Даны целые числа 1\leq n\leq {10}^{18} и 2\leq m\leq {10}^{5}, необходимо найти остаток от деления n-го числа Фибоначчи на m. n =...

Числа Фибоначчи - C++
Числа Фибоначчи{u}_{0},{u}_{1},{u}_{2} .... определяются следующим образом:{u}_{0}=0,{u}_{1}=1,{u}_{n}={u}_{n-1}+{u}_{n-2} (n = 2,3, ...)....

Числа Фибоначчи - C++
Является ли число N числом Фибоначчи? (С++) Как выглядит программа с использованием if или while?

Числа Фибоначчи - C++
Помогите решить задачу. Дан список чисел. Вывести те из них, которые являются числами Фибоначчи. Выводить в том порядке, в каком...

Числа Фибоначчи - C++
Дан файл, компоненты которого являются предположительно последовательными числами Фибоначчи {u}_{0}, {u}_{1}, ... , {u}_{n}. Проверить...

числа Фибоначчи- 2 - C++
Числа Фибоначчи строятся следующим образом: 1, 1, 2, 3, 5, …. В этой последовательности, начиная с третьего числа, каждый следующий член...

Числа Фибоначчи - C++
1ое задание: Числа Фибоначчи определяются формулами f0 =f1 = 1; fn = fn-1 + fn-2 при n =2,3,… Определить 40-е число Фибоначчи,...

Числа Фибоначчи - C++
Здраствуйте! Есть такое задание С максимальной эффективностью решить данную задачу: Вывести количество чисел Фибоначчи (0, 1, 1, 2,...

Числа Фибоначчи! - C++
Помогите написать вот такую ​​программу: Заданная последовательность n действительных чисел. Вычислить сумму чисел, порядковые номера...

Числа Фибоначчи - C++
Последовательность чисел Фибоначчи характеризуется тем, что она начинается с0, далее идет 1, а каждый следующий элемент является суммой...

Числа фибоначчи - C++
в чем недостаток этого алгоритма чисел фибоначчи? #include <iostream> using namespace std; int main() { __int64 a; int n; ...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
После регистрации реклама в сообщениях будет скрыта и будут доступны все возможности форума.
D_Ok
44 / 33 / 12
Регистрация: 11.02.2014
Сообщений: 134
23.04.2014, 17:44     Числа Фибоначчи #2
C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
#include <iostream>
int fibonachi(int n);
int main()
{
    using namespace std;
    int n;
    cin >> n;
    cout << "Fibonachi digit [" << n << "] is " << fibonachi(n) << endl;
    return 0;
}
int fibonachi(int n)
{
    if (n == 0)
        return 0;
    else if (n == 1)
        return 1;
    else return fibonachi(n-1)+fibonachi(n-2);
    
}
Kuzia domovenok
1889 / 1744 / 117
Регистрация: 25.03.2012
Сообщений: 5,922
Записей в блоге: 1
23.04.2014, 17:46     Числа Фибоначчи #3
C++
1
2
3
4
long Fib(unsigned long n){
if (n==1 || n==2) return 1;
else return Fib(n-1)+Fib(n-2);
}
А обязательно ли рекурсивно решать, кстати? Ведь рекурсия для поиска чисел Фибоначчи - не самый оптимальный алгоритм. Итерации быстрее.
Yandex
Объявления
23.04.2014, 17:46     Числа Фибоначчи
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ru